I had the pleasure of leading the wonderful GoodGym Hammersmith and Fulham last night and they didn't let me down.

Seventeen wonderful runners joined me on a warm and sunny last evening of July. This week we were helping Acknowledging Youth (AY) a charity that works to help disadvantaged young people attaining employment by providing support and also formal clothes for interviews to younger people.

Tonight the task was to deliver leaflets for AY. We had two sets of leaflets - one for shops that would hopefully donate clothes to the scheme and one for local residents to donate their time to scheme. We split into two groups with Jason (team One) leading one and myself and Will (team Two) leading the other - to add a bit of fun to the proceedings we also had a scavenger hunt, which proved a good plan as we found that we delivered all the leaflets in no time!
